Job Summary
The IT Service Desk Lead is responsible for leading and managing a 24x7 global IT Service Desk operation supporting end users across multiple locations. The role is accountable for service delivery excellence, SLA compliance, team leadership, customer satisfaction, incident management, continuous service improvement, and operational governance. The Service Desk Lead acts as the primary escalation point for critical issues and drives operational efficiency through process optimization, automation, and knowledge management initiatives.
